The Hidden Meanings Behind Refrigerator Dreams
Many people experience dreams that involve common household items, with refrigerators being particularly intriguing. When dreaming of a refrigerator, you might find it empty or filled, cold, or stocked with vibrant foods. However, these dreams often unravel deeper layers of emotional significance.
The refrigerator can serve as a powerful symbol of loneliness, reflecting both our emotional states and our relationships with others. In today’s world, where connections can be fleeting and interactions often shallow, dreaming about a refrigerator can mirror feelings of isolation or feelings of longing for deeper connections. The act of opening a fridge may also signify an attempt to nourish oneself emotionally, representing our desires for comfort, satisfaction, and companionship.
This dream invites us to reflect on our personal needs, emotional balance, and the relationships that truly feed our souls.

Ways to Navigate Your Feelings After This Dream
- Reflect on Your Emotional Needs
Dreaming of a refrigerator as a symbol of loneliness can prompt a moment of self-reflection. Consider journaling about your emotions and your current relationships. Ask yourself: 'What am I feeling?
Am I receiving the emotional support I need?' This reflective practice can help illuminate areas in your life where you might be feeling disconnected. Additionally, remind yourself that it’s essential to nourish not only your physical body but also your emotional needs. Reaching out to friends or loved ones, and expressing how you feel can reinforce bonds that may have weakened over time.
- Create a Supportive Environment
Utilize this dream as a catalyst for change in your life. If feelings of isolation persist, actively foster environments that encourage connection. This could mean hosting gatherings, joining clubs, or engaging in community activities.
Creating a supportive circle can alleviate feelings of loneliness. Consider cooking your favorite meals with friends; food often acts as a bridge, bringing people together. Remember, a refrigerator symbolizes sustenance, so fill your life with experiences and relationships that bring joy and fulfillment.
- Explore New Hobbies or Interests
To combat feelings of loneliness, immerse yourself in new activities. Whether it's taking a class, picking up a new hobby, or exploring volunteer opportunities, engaging with others can help rekindle connections. Not only does exploring hobbies provide a healthy distraction, but it also opens up opportunities to meet like-minded individuals.
Dreams of refrigerators may indicate an empty emotional reservoir, so filling your life with fulfilling experiences can lead to more enriching social interactions. Seek out groups where shared interests can foster new friendships.
- Consider Professional Guidance
If dreams of loneliness persist or feelings of isolation become overwhelming, seeking the help of a mental health professional can be a vital step. Therapists can provide tools and strategies to help you navigate your emotional landscape, whether addressing feelings of loneliness or understanding patterns in your dreams. A professional can help tailor your journey toward healing, guiding you to build fulfilling relationships in your waking life.
- Practice Mindfulness and Self-Care
Engaging in mindfulness practices can help ground you when loneliness creeps in. Simple practices such as meditation, yoga, or spending time in nature create a sense of connection with oneself, combating feelings of emptiness. Ensure you engage in regular self-care activities that replenish your emotional energy, whether it’s taking walks, reading your favorite books, or indulging in calming hobbies.
Remember, a nourished soul reflects a well-stocked refrigerator; care for yourself deeply, and you’ll naturally begin to attract more positive emotional connections.
